Output ef22c2a13b2626bf0f0a5f07454ed7bf32b3de82a8505397074989c0ae825a0a:0

value
73720000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aafc030471ffc710dcf7cf137fc8e3758f9c677f OP_EQUAL
address
MPVF18LNGNq5TxcdNqtVgMDzcyucHxkjeD
transaction
ef22c2a13b2626bf0f0a5f07454ed7bf32b3de82a8505397074989c0ae825a0a
spent
true